Company Overview
Copper Cane Wines & Spirits, nestled in the heart of Napa Valley, embodies a harmonious blend of innovation and genuine craftsmanship, offering a touch of luxury for everyday indulgence. With a rich portfolio that includes Belle Glos Pinot Noirs from California's coastal vineyards, Quilt Napa Valley Cabernet Sauvignon, Böen by Belle Glos Tri County Chardonnay, and Pinot Noir, as well as THREADCOUNT by Quilt, Copper Cane is a testament to the art of winemaking.
As a fifth-generation Napa Valley winemaker, Joe learned his way around a vineyard long before he could drink wine. By the age of nineteen, he knew he would continue his family's winemaking legacy, collaborating with his father at Caymus Vineyards. In 2001, he created Belle Glos, focusing on vineyard-designated Pinot Noirs from California's best coastal regions. More recently, Joe has launched several latest brands under Copper Cane Wines & Spirits, contributing to the evolution of the wine industry by discovering new wine-growing locations and experimenting in the cellar.
